Убрал захардкоженый путь, добавил хотелки
This commit is contained in:
parent
bff6249173
commit
82efe0ce8c
@ -1,6 +1,8 @@
|
|||||||
#!/usr/bin/python3
|
#!/usr/bin/python3
|
||||||
|
|
||||||
# база со стримерами в json файле
|
# FIXME: не создавать папки для несуществующих стримеров
|
||||||
|
# TODO: Сделать нормальную конфигурацию
|
||||||
|
# TODO: Автоматически удалять старые стримы
|
||||||
|
|
||||||
import os
|
import os
|
||||||
from threading import Thread
|
from threading import Thread
|
||||||
@ -23,8 +25,9 @@ def recorder(i):
|
|||||||
path = config_python.path + "/"+ i
|
path = config_python.path + "/"+ i
|
||||||
print("Записываем стрим %s\n" % i)
|
print("Записываем стрим %s\n" % i)
|
||||||
# FIXME: пофиксить абсолютный путь
|
# FIXME: пофиксить абсолютный путь
|
||||||
cmdline = ["/home/losted/.local/bin/youtube-dl","https://twitch.tv/"+i]
|
cmdline = ["youtube-dl","https://twitch.tv/"+i]
|
||||||
import subprocess
|
import subprocess
|
||||||
|
# Не хочу делать тут проверку на существование "youtube-dl" в $PATH
|
||||||
s = subprocess.call(cmdline, stdout=subprocess.DEVNULL)
|
s = subprocess.call(cmdline, stdout=subprocess.DEVNULL)
|
||||||
print("Запись стрима %s закончена\n" % i)
|
print("Запись стрима %s закончена\n" % i)
|
||||||
if (os.path.exists(path+"/pid")):
|
if (os.path.exists(path+"/pid")):
|
||||||
@ -65,6 +68,7 @@ def checkAlive(streamers, client_id):
|
|||||||
|
|
||||||
|
|
||||||
def removeOldStreams():
|
def removeOldStreams():
|
||||||
|
# https://clck.ru/WHh32
|
||||||
pass
|
pass
|
||||||
|
|
||||||
if __name__ == "__main__":
|
if __name__ == "__main__":
|
||||||
|
Loading…
Reference in New Issue
Block a user